Dear all, I am thinking about whether we should use NISO ALI with JATS, especially for referencing to the public license (CC BY) of articles. I found this recommendation in the JATS documentation: JATS best practice is to omit the @xlink:href attribute from <license> if a > NISO ALI ali:license_ref> is used. see: https://jats.nlm.nih.gov/publishing/tag-library/1.2/element/ali-license_ref.h tml However, I am not sure about the "if" part of this recommendation: Is it advisable (or when is it advisable) to use NISO ALI ( https://www.niso.org/schemas/ali/1.0) ? My impression is that NISO ALI until now is not widely adopted/supported. Any thoughts on this? Thanks!
